Biography: Dr. Ashley Tovo is a member of the Women's Health Alliance team. She is known for her devotion and passion for women's health. A Charleston, West Virginia native, she graduated with honors from Washington and Lee University before earning her medical degree from Marshall University School of Medicine. Dr. Tovo's residency at Baylor University Medical Center in Dallas was marked by awards in achievement including the Outstanding Resident in Obstetrics and Gynecology by the Southern Gynecologic Assembly and the Joseph Warren Award for Resident Excellence.Board Certified by the American Board of Obstetrics and Gynecology, Dr. Tovo is dedicated to providing comprehensive women's health care including contraceptive management, high-risk pregnancy, minimally invasive pelvic surgery, and menopause. She is deeply committed to advancing patient care through innovative treatments and comprehensive practice.Outside the hospital, Dr. Tovo enjoys spending time with her family, including her husband and three children. Dr. Tovo is an enthusiastic marathon runner, reader, traveler and skier.

Biography: A native of Dallas, Dr. Jay Staub has been in practice since 1983, delivering personalized health care for women in Dallas. Following his graduation from the University of Pennsylvania, he attended the University of Texas Southwestern Medical School and received his medical degree in 1979. He completed his residency training at St. Paul Hospital in Dallas. He is Board Certified and a Fellow of the American Congress of Obstetrics and Gynecology.A Clinical Professor in the department of Ob/Gyn at The University of Texas Southwestern Medical School, Dr. Staub is actively involved in teaching medical students and residents. His practice specializes in a wide spectrum of women's care general OB/GYN, infertility, routine and high-risk prenatal care, gynecologic surgery, minimally invasive procedures such as Hysteroscopy, Laparoscopy, and Laparoscopic hysterectomy, as well as the evaluation and management menopause. He was one of the few gynecologists in the area that performed MRI guided focused ultrasound non-invasive treatment for uterine fibroids.Dr. Staub was selected as one of "The Best Doctors in Dallas" by D Magazine in 2004-2009, 2013-16, and again in 2020-21, and 2023-24, as well as a "Texas Super Doctor" by Texas Monthly in 2004, 2005 and for fourteen consecutive years in 2011-24. He was also picked by his patients to be a "Mom-Approved Doc" by Dallas Child in 2012-16, and again in 2024. In addition, Dr. Staub was elected by his peers for inclusion in Best Doctors in America® from 2009 to 2010. He and his wife, Lynn are the proud parents of four children and thirteen grandchildren. He enjoys golfing, snow skiing and other outdoor activities during his leisure time.

Biography: Dr. Romberg grew up in the suburbs of San Diego, CA. She earned her bachelor's degree withsumma cum laude honors from the University of California at San Diego. She attended bothgraduate and medical school at UT Southwestern, where she earned both her master's degree ingenetics and her medical degree. She then went on to complete her residency in obstetrics andgynecology at Baylor University Medical Center in Dallas in June 2005. Shortly thereafter, shejoined the excellent physicians at Women's Health Alliance.Dr. Romberg has been board certified in Obstetrics and Gynecology since 2007. She earnednumerous awards throughout her education including the DFW OB/GYN society award foroutstanding medical student and the W.K. Strother award for excellence in clinical and academicachievement during residency. She is a fellow of the American College of Obstetrics andGynecology and belongs to the AMA, TMA, and the Dallas County Medical Society.Dr. Romberg cares for women through all stages of life, from the teenage years throughchildbearing and midlife into menopause, including hormone therapy. She is skilled atperforming minimally-invasive laparoscopy with the DaVinci robotic platform, such ashysterectomy, cystectomy, endometriosis resection, and salpingectomies for sterilization. Sheenjoys delivering babies, both routine and high-risk pregnancies. She also performs in-officeprocedures including endometrial ablation for heavy bleeding, hysteroscopy, colposcopy toevaluate abnormal Pap smears, LEEP for treatment of cervical dysplasia, and placement of long-term reversible contraceptives such as IUDs and implants.Away from her practice she enjoys spending time with her husband Kirk and four kids, reading,being active in her church community & step-family ministry, cheering on her kids at theiractivities, traveling and attending the theater.

Biography: Dr. Myears loves making personal connections with her patients and looks forward to taking care of women throughout all stages of life, from contraceptive counseling to pregnancy to the menopausal transition. She feels lucky that women trust her with their health journey and prioritizes shared decision making when forming management plans. She has a special interest in adolescent contraceptive management, both high and low risk pregnancies, addressing modifiable risk factors for cancer, and PCOS. She performs in office procedures such as biopsies, long acting reversible contraceptives, hysteroscopy, and LEEP, as well as robotic myomectomies, endometriosis procedures, and hysterectomies in the hospital.Dr. Myears was raised in Springfield, Missouri. She graduated from the University of Missouri summa cum laude and then moved to Dallas to attend UT Southwestern for medical school. She stayed in Dallas for residency at Parkland Hospital, one of the highest volume obstetric hospitals in the nation. She served as chief resident and won several teaching awards from the medical students and residents. In her free time, she enjoys reading and listening to audiobooks, traveling, cooking, and spending time with her husband and the two best boys in the whole world.
